Arrow S7E18 ‘Lost Canary’ promo released

The CW has released a brand new promo for the eighteenth episode of Arrow season seven, titled ‘Lost Canary’ which sees Laurel Lance’s dark history come back to haunt her!

By outing Emiko Queen to Oliver, the current District Attorney of Star City now finds herself in trouble as the new Green Arrow is getting her revenge. In retaliation, Emiko is framing Laurel for a murder of a witness in SCPD custody, as well as revealing a photo with her and the late Diaz, leading Lance to go on the run.

In the episode that pays homage to the Birds of Prey comics, Dinah Lance/Black Canary is set to team up with Sara Lance/White Canary from DC’s Legends of Tomorrow to help bring down Black Siren…

Check out the promo below!

Arrow episode 7.18 “Lost Canary” will air on Monday 15th April on The CW.

Nicola Austin

Lover of all things Marvel, DC, Game of Thrones, Disney, Pokemon and Studio Ghibli. Favourite superhero is Ms Marvel closely followed by Spider-Man.

Nicola Austin has 1814 posts and counting. See all posts by Nicola Austin

Leave a Reply

Your email address will not be published. Required fields are marked *